This trail is maintained for foot and horse traffic since it lies within the Wenah-Tucannon Wilderness. From Elk Flat Trailhead, the trail drops drastically for 1 1/2 miles to a flat which lasts 1/2 mile, and then descends 3 miles gradually to the Wenaha Forks Area on the Wenaha River. There is a large area available for parking at the trailhead with a spring fed small creek available for watering stock. The trail is heavily laden with mosquitoes at the trailhead and on past the flat section along the trail. Yet, access to the Wenaha River and to other fishing opportunities are available off this trail. Large area for camping opportunities at the Wenaha Forks area. Views of the South Fork of the Wenaha drainage are available on the lower sections of the trail.
